PHP中的addslashes()函数

addslashes()函数返回预定义字符前面带有反斜杠的字符串。它返回一个在预定义字符前带有反斜杠的字符串。

预定义的字符如下:单引号('),双引号(“),反斜杠(\)和NULL

语法

addslashes(str)

参数

  • str- 指定要转义的字符串

返回

addslashes()函数返回一个在预定义字符前带有反斜杠的字符串。

示例

以下是一个例子-

<?php
   $s = "Who's Tom Hanks?";
   echo $s . " Unsafe for database query!<br>";
   echo addslashes($s) . " 在数据库查询中安全!";
?>

输出结果

Who's Tom Hanks? Unsafe for database query!
Who\'s Tom Hanks? 在数据库查询中安全!

示例

让我们看另一个例子-

<?php
   $s = addslashes('Cricket is a “religion” in India.');
   echo($s);
?>

输出结果

Cricket is a “religion” in India.